DocPulse is a local-first MCP (Model Context Protocol) Server that transforms massive documentation into high-density, LLM-ready "Implementation Manifestos."
Built for Apple Silicon, it leverages native MLX for local inference, combined with intelligent web crawling and community context search (Reddit/StackOverflow) to provide a 360-degree view of any library, standard, or regulation.
- Token Efficiency: Scraping and distilling docs locally saves a massive amount of tokens. Instead of sending thousands of raw HTML lines to a cloud LLM, you send only a dense, 2-3 page distilled manifesto.
- Internal Network Support: Designed to work seamlessly within organizational networks. If your documentation is hosted on an internal wiki or API that doesn't require MFA/Auth, DocPulse can ingest it and provide context without exposing sensitive raw data to external scraping services.

DocPulse is designed for a seamless, zero-config startup experience.
- Dynamic Model Selection: On launch, DocPulse detects your system's total RAM and automatically selects the most capable model from our curated DeepSeek-R1 Distill suite:
- < 24GB RAM:
7B(High-speed, minimal overhead). - 24GB - 64GB RAM:
14B(Deep extraction & reasoning). - > 64GB RAM:
32B(Maximum fidelity for complex standards).
- < 24GB RAM:
- Auto-Bootstrapping: The system automatically initializes your local config at
~/.config/docpulse/, creates the required cache directories, and downloads MLX model weights on demand. - Environment Configuration: We provide a comprehensive
.env.exampletemplate. Simplycp .env.example .envto manage optional search API keys (Brave/Google) or force a specific model size using theDOCPULSE_MODELoverride.

DocPulse features a robust, tiered configuration system.
Settings are loaded in the following priority:
- User Config:
~/.config/docpulse/config.toml - Default Config:
config.default.toml(bundled with the repo)
You can override any of these keys in your config.toml:
name: The name of the MCP server.log_level: Set toDEBUG,INFO,WARNING, orERROR.
text_extensions: List of file extensions to include in recursive scans.encoding: Default encoding for local files (default:utf-8).
max_tokens: Maximum output length for the manifesto.temperature: LLM sampling temperature.
Prompts are no longer stored in the TOML configuration. Instead, they live in the prompts/ directory.
- Priority:
~/.config/docpulse/prompts/{name}.txt>prompts/{name}.txt. - Placeholder tokens:
{raw_text},{community_context},{human_feedback}.
Maps model repository strings to minimum RAM requirements (GB).
Used for sensitive keys and quick overrides:
DOCPULSE_MODEL: The pipeline strictly defaults to a 7B model because data extraction relies heavily on deletion/formatting rather than novel synthesis. Overtaxing VRAM with a 32B model causes severe bottlenecks. If you must override this, set this variable to14B,32B, or a full HuggingFace repo link.DOCPULSE_CACHE_DIR: Set the directory where distilled documentation is saved (defaults to.docpulse_cachein the current working directory).BRAVE_API_KEY: For Brave Search augmentation.GOOGLE_API_KEY&GOOGLE_CSE_ID: For Google Search augmentation.- Note: DuckDuckGo is the default and requires no key.

uv run pytest tests/ -vDocPulse is designed to survive reboots and server restarts without losing data.
- File-System Cache: All distilled context is saved to a local caching directory. By default, this is an operational
.docpulse_cache/directory in the current working directory. You can override this local folder using theDOCPULSE_CACHE_DIRenvironment variable. - Automatic Directory Management: The application will automatically ensure the caching directory exists before saving files to it, keeping things zero-configuration.
- Cache-First Logic: Before performing a new harvest or distillation, the server checks the caching directory. If a match is found, it returns the stored result instantly.
- Feedback Loop: Human feedback and failure reports are persisted in the
feedback/subdirectory of the cache and are automatically injected into future distillation prompts for that subject.
